Apple's Manufacturing & Operations team is looking for an extraordinary Machine Learning Engineer with expertise in Computer Vision (CV) and Large Language Models (LLMs) to join our team. You will craft, design and implement our machine learning strategy to the massive iPhone, Mac, iPad supply chains and help build the future of our manufacturing systems. In this role, you will develop and deploy machine learning models to optimize processes, automate quality control, and improve operational efficiency. The role requires a candidate with practical experience fine-tuning LLMs and applying them in combination with CV techniques to tackle challenges in manufacturing environments.

Collaborate with engineering and operations teams to deliver cutting-edge ML technologies, ensuring top-tier product quality and reliability in a fast-paced environment. - Develop and deploy scalable Computer Vision and Machine Learning algorithms on local and cloud-based inferencing platforms. - Perform rapid prototyping to design algorithms for challenging real world manufacturing problems in the domain of Intelligent Visual Inspection. - Leverage Large Language Models to automate document analysis, knowledge extraction, and process optimization within manufacturing workflow. - Fine-tune LLMs for domain-specific applications such as improving operational documentation, production reports, and automating technical analysis. - Work with resources in cross-functional teams and the factory to integrate ML applications. - Abilities to independently learn new technologies; prioritize tasks and take ownership; and meaningfully present results of analyses in a clear and impactful manner.
Minimum Qualifications
- Experience developing deep learning models such as CNNs, Vision Transformers, or YOLO for image-based tasks in production systems.
- Proven research and practical experience in developing algorithms for image processing, content-based video/image analysis, object detection, segmentation and tracking
- Proven experience in fine-tuning LLMs for domain-specific use cases such as document analysis and operational efficiency.
- Master's in computer science, Machine Learning, or higher level degree is preferred with of 3+ years of related industry experience in Machine Learning, Computer Science, Data Science or related fields.
- iOS CoreImage/CoreML and native App development experience is a big plus.
- Experience deploying ML models in cloud environments (AWS, GCP, or Azure) for scalable production use.
Preferred Qualifications
- Strong grasp of deep learning principles in both Computer Vision and Natural Language Processing (NLP).
- Familiarity with LLM architectures like BERT, GPT, and experience fine-tuning these models for improved performance in manufacturing settings.
- Knowledge of machine learning and Deep Learning libraries such as PyTorch, OpenCV, Hugging Face, is essential.
- Proven ability to implement, improve, debug, and maintain machine learning models.
- Familiar with version control systems such as Git.
- Strong optimization and debugging skills.
